Transaction 7590aff820b24f520e9902d571803c71252d14a35725cbc8a037ec12d7c5f581

2 Input
2 Outputs
  • 7590aff820b24f520e9902d571803c71252d14a35725cbc8a037ec12d7c5f581:0
  • value  851456
    address  132PebBS4gXbaxiAyDgY9QxUz25t9DeTCm
  • 7590aff820b24f520e9902d571803c71252d14a35725cbc8a037ec12d7c5f581:1
  • value  8671220
    address  39hyLEpfvho9m1BrEKAo9uUVES2dySbbQB